    The PEMDAS rule, also known as the Order of Operations, is a simple yet powerful tool for solving mathematical expressions involving multiple operations. In the US, the increasing use of calculators and online tools has made it easier for students to perform calculations quickly but has also made it easier to make mistakes. The PEMDAS rule helps ensure that mathematical expressions are evaluated consistently and accurately, reducing errors and promoting confidence in math problem-solving.

PEMDAS is not a complex computer term, but a simple mathematical tool that helps us solve expressions involving multiple operations. It ensures that we follow a consistent order, which makes math problem-solving much easier.

              • One common misconception is that the order of operations should be indicated using PEAR instead of PEMDAS, but this is not the case. The correct order is 'Parentheses, Exponents, Multiplication and Division, and Addition and Subtraction.
